CROWDS of rain-soaked protesters waved their banners outside Downing Street in a bid to make their voices heard about the closure of Chesham Bois Post Office.

Chiltern District councillor Mimi Harker (Con, Chesham Bois and Weedon Hill) who organised Monday's event, said it was a successful day and praised the community for its support.

A small group of supporters knocked on Number Ten and handed in a 600-signature petition to Tony Blair, asking him to save the Bois Lane store.

Cllr Harker also added a personal letter to the Prime Minister, asking him to visit the counter when he makes a trip to Chequers.
